Oracle联合Vim,改变我们的数据文字处理方式(oracle vim)

追求高效、冗长文本编辑能力的程序员们,一定经常使用Vim编辑器。当他们需要在数据库中处理数据时,往往只能采用Oracle SQL Developer等工具来进行,而这些工具的文本编辑能力十分有限。但是,现在,一个新的方式正在改变数据文字处理方式:Oracle联合vim。

Oracle 和 Vim 的结合

Oracle联合Vim的目标是为了让Vim的强大编辑功能用于Oracle数据处理。不幸的是,Oracle SQL Developer自带的SQL Worksheet虽然可以编辑简单的SQL语句,但很难有效地编辑复杂的SQL。因此,许多程序员使用Vim来编写SQL语句,然后将其复制回Oracle SQL Developer,这样做既增加了时间,也增加了复制和粘贴的麻烦。

Oracle联合Vim的出现,旨在让程序员能够在Vim编辑器中直接编辑Oracle数据库中的数据,省去了复制和粘贴的时间,而且更加高效。

Oracle联合Vim的好处

Oracle联合Vim的好处在于,它使得程序员能够在Vim编辑器中使用所有已知的编辑特性来处理数据。这包括所有Vim提供的特性,如快速的文本搜索、替换、正则表达式、分屏、标签等功能。另外,Vim的语法高亮和自动完成功能也可以让程序员更加快速地编写SQL语句,并减少错误。

如何实现Oracle联合Vim

以Oracle和Vim Linux系统为例,Oracle联合Vim的实现需要注意以下两个方面。

1. VIM中安装Oracle插件

通过安装插件来使Vim能够连接到Oracle数据库,从而直接编辑数据。Oracle插件可以通过在~/.vim目录下创建bundle目录,并在该目录中复制Oracle插件的Github仓库地址来实现。安装完成后,Vim可以通过指定一个连接字符串来连接到Oracle数据库,如下所示:

“`vim

:connect user/passwd@host:port/service_name


2. Oracle 中启用外部编辑器

在Oracle中启用外部编辑器需要改变SQL Developer的首选项。在SQL Developer菜单中选择"首选项",然后选择"数据库"选项卡。在"外部编辑器"区域,选择"Vim"或"gvim",并指定正确的可执行路径。启用后,程序员就可以在SQL Developer中双击一个表或视图,然后转到编辑器中直接编辑数据。

结语

使用Oracle联合Vim,程序员可以更加高效地编辑Oracle数据库中的数据,这对数据分析和处理操作来说是极其有益的。通过Oracle联合Vim的使用,可以充分发挥Vim的编辑能力,同时避免了复制和粘贴工作带来的麻烦。如果要使用Oracle联合Vim,需要注意插件和SQL Developer的相关配置,才能顺利地实现Vim作为Oracle数据库编辑器的效果。

数据运维技术 » Oracle联合Vim,改变我们的数据文字处理方式(oracle vim)